841,203,928,857,600 is an even composite number composed of six pr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 841203928857600 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 6 prime factors (large circles) and 5148 divisors.

841203928857600 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five thousand, one hundred forty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 841203928857600:

210 × 312 × 52 × 7 × 112 × 73

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 73)
